Andain
Andain was a San Francisco-based electronic music duo, originally formed in 2000. They broke through in 2002 after being discovered by DJ Tiësto, reaching clubbers worldwide with their singles "Summer Calling" in 2002 and "Beautiful Things" in 2003. The band members initially included producer Josh Gabriel, singer and songwriter Mavie Marcos, and guitarist David Penner, before the group disbanded in 2006. Andain returned again in 2011 as Josh and Mavie, making their comeback with the single "Promises". The successive year saw the release of the band's first and only full-length album, on September 12, 2012, following a year of touring and performing. Andain was eventually concluded in 2014. Biography 2000–06: Initial works Andain began as an experimental electronica group in 2000, making their breakthrough in 2002 with the song "Summer Calling", after getting attention from Tiësto and signing with Black Hole. You Once Told Me
''You Once Told Me'' is the first officially released studio album from Andain, succeeding ten years of various works and performances. Overview Released on September 24, 2012 through Black Hole, ''You Once Told Me'' had been written over a span of four years, from 2007 to 2011. The album was promoted with three singles prior to its release, starting with "Promises" in June 2011, " Much Too Much" by the end of January 2012, and " Turn Up the Sound" on June 18, 2012. After much patience following unsettled circumstances, the album was officially announced on August 10, 2012, on Andain's official Facebook page. With a complementary note about album previews to come the following week, a teaser of the album track "Like" was posted on Facebook, on August 17, 2012. Promises (Andain Song)
"Promises" is the third single from Andain, and remarks a comeback after eight years since their previous release. It's also the first promotional single taken from the duo's debut album, ''You Once Told Me''. Overview The song made its debut on YouTube with the première of its official music video, posted by Black Hole on June 1, 2011. The single followed on June 6, 2011, as two exclusive digital releases: a five track remix EP on Beatport, and a three track single on iTunes, featuring the album version of the song. A follow-up remix EP with additional remixes was released on June 13, 2011. Prior to its release, "Promises" received promotional support from a selected crew of DJs, being featured in live sets, podcasts and radio shows in the form of various remixes. Much Too Much (Andain Song)
"Much Too Much" is the fourth release from electronica duo Andain, and the second promotional single taken from the subsequent studio album, ''You Once Told Me''. Overview The single was initially released as a digital download on January 30, 2012, featuring the album version of the song, a chillout remix by Zetandel, and a radio edit. A second issue with additional remixes was later released on February 27, 2012, which featured two drum and bass remixes by Relay & Front and Rido, and a drumstep remix by Shreddward & Exceed. Also, defining a third issue of the single, a trance remix by Mike Shiver was released on April 23, 2012. The song's official music video premièred on February 2, 2012, on YouTube, three days after the single's initial release. An alternative version of the video was later released on March 13, 2012, which featured the remix by Zetandel. Simultaneously, the remix in question was also being promoted as a free download. Beautiful Things (Andain Song)
"Beautiful Things" is the second release by Andain. It first appeared on Tiësto's compilation album '' Nyana'', released May 6, 2003, and was later published as a single via Black Hole, on October 27, 2003. Overview While "Beautiful Things" was promoted and released as a remix by Gabriel & Dresden, the song originally started out as an unreleased guitar track titled "Annie". In response to a request from Tiësto for a follow-up to the single "Summer Calling", "Annie" was rewritten to become a club track, also changing the lyrics from a narrative third person view to first person. According to Mavie, "Beautiful Things" is, "in a general sense, about feeling stuck; in a place, time, you just can’t get yourself out of". The Gabriel & Dresden remix per se is characterized by a sharp beat and thick bassline. Josh Gabriel
Josh Gabriel is an American electronic dance music DJ and producer, most known for his collaborative partnership Gabriel & Dresden with Dave Dresden. History Early years (1988–2000) In 1988-89, a 20-year-old exchange student from California Institute of the Arts, was living in The Hague in The Netherlands and studying at the Institute of Sonology. Josh Gabriel had already been working with digital music since his high-school days, achieving mastery of the DX7 and TX816 by the age of 17. With an Apple Macintosh Plus, operating system 3, and the earliest of music applications like Mark of the Unicorn's "Composer" and "Performer", Josh was already at the bleeding edge. In the Netherlands, Gabriel's inventor spirit took shape as he wrote a computer application to control samples on an Akai S900 in real-time with a joystick. Turn Up The Sound
"Turn Up the Sound" is the fifth release from Andain, marking the third and last promotional single prior to the duo's debut album, '' You Once Told Me''. Overview The single was released as two packages, each running as a Beatport exclusive for two weeks. The first part was released on June 18, 2012 as a remix EP, and featured three club mixes: two in the style of trance by tyDi and Xtigma, and one electro house remix by Francis Prève. The second part followed on July 2, 2012, and featured seven tracks, including an electro house remix by Tristan Garner; a drumstep remix by Stratus; a chillout remix by Zetandel; a trance remix by Gabriel & Dresden; and the album version of the song, in addition to one radio edit for each of the latter two mixes. Eventually, the song would also feature a music video, making its first appearance on YouTube, July 19, 2012. Gabriel & Dresden
Gabriel & Dresden is an American electronic music duo comprising Josh Gabriel and Dave Dresden, formed in San Francisco, California. They collaborated from 2001 to 2008, then again from 2011 to the present. During that time, they have created numerous hit songs and remixes, some of which are considered classics. They won the coveted Winter Music Conference IDMA award for "Best American DJ" twice, in 2007 and 2008, the latter time on the same day that the group split up. The pair reunited in early 2011 and proceeded on a reunion tour, which began at Ruby Skye in San Francisco on March 4, 2011. They produced three studio albums together: self-titled album (2006), '' The Only Road'' (2017) which was released after an 11-year hiatus period, and Remedy (2020). Bloom (Gabriel & Dresden Album)
''Bloom'' is a 2004 compilation album by Gabriel & Dresden that collects songs by the duo and various other artists from the Nettwerk label. The first three tracks were originally featured on the EP ''Arcadia''. Nyana (album)
''Nyana'' is a double disc album by trance producer and DJ Tiësto, released on May 6, 2003. Disc one is labeled ''Outdoor'', while the second CD is labeled ''Indoor''. According to the FAQ section on Tiësto's official website: "On a visit in South Africa, Tiësto was introduced to a cheetah named Nyana". In Swahili "nyana" means sunrise.
